mission · from form 990

OUR MISSION IS TO ENABLE ARIZONA FAMILIES TO ENROLL THEIR CHILDREN AT THEIR SCHOOL OF CHOICE WHICH BEST MEETS THE NEEDS OF EACH INDIVIDUAL CHILD, THROUGH THE ARIZONA TUITION TAX CREDIT PROGRAM AT NO OUT OF POCKET COST TO TAXPAYERS.

profile · synthesized from sources

STO4KIDZ is an Arizona-based School Tuition Organization that provides K-12 private school scholarships to eligible students. The organization enables individuals and corporations to redirect their state tax liabilities as dollar-for-dollar tax credits to fund these scholarships, ensuring no out-of-pocket cost to taxpayers. Its mission is to facilitate school choice for Arizona families.

named programs · 5 · from sources

what they call their work

Charitable Giving
Accepts fully tax-deductible donations from individuals, regardless of their location, to fund K-12 private school scholarships.
Corporate Tuition Tax Credit
Enables corporations to allocate up to 100% of their state income tax liabilities through the Low-Income and Disabled/Displaced Tax Credit programs to fund K-12 private school scholarships.
Individual Tuition Tax Credit
Allows individuals to redirect their Arizona state tax liabilities to STO4KIDZ to create tuition financial aid for K-12 students, receiving a dollar-for-dollar tax credit.
Matching Gifts
Facilitates employer matching of donations and tax credit contributions, allowing donors to multiply their impact on student scholarships.
Payroll Withholding
Allows individuals to authorize their employer to send their state withholding tax amount to STO4KIDZ, contributing to scholarships in smaller amounts without affecting their take-home pay, while still claiming the tax credit.
